    Statement Issued by the General Command of the Army and Armed Forces

    In recent days, our armed forces have fought fierce battles to repel and thwart the violent and successive attacks launched by terrorist organizations on the city of Hama from various fronts, with large numbers of fighters using all available means and military equipment, and supported by infiltration groups.

    During the past hours, as confrontations intensified between our soldiers and terrorist groups, and as the number of martyrs in our ranks increased, these groups managed to breach several axes in the city and enter it, despite suffering heavy losses.

    In order to protect the lives of civilians in the city of Hama and to avoid involving them in urban combat, the stationed military units have redeployed and repositioned themselves outside the city.

    The General Command of the Army and Armed Forces affirms that it will continue to fulfill its national duty in reclaiming areas that have been infiltrated by terrorist organizations.

    It seems that the Syrian Army has also abandoned Hama and is retreating towards Homs. They must defend Homs at all costs because the oil pipelines coming from eastern Syria converge there, and it leads to Latakia and Tartus. Additionally, there is a large refinery in Homs.

    "The settlement of Akerbat in the province of Hama came under the control of militants.

    The same one for which the Wagner PMC stormtroopers fought hard in the summer and fall of 2017, and which was completely taken by the forces of the "orchestra" assault squads on September 15, including the forces of the 1st ShO Ratibor. After the capture of the city, the Syrian army entered it beautifully in front of the cameras.

    Scouts of the 3rd Guards Separate Special Forces Brigade and SSO specialists also took part in the storming of Akerbat. It was for the battles near Akerbat that Corporal Denis Portnyagin received the Hero of Russia star; in August 2017, during the advance to the city, servicemen of the 3rd Brigade were killed - Captain Kurban Kasumov and Sergeant Valery Evdyukov."
